Position Purpose
Constructs, maintains, and tests electrical systems and components. Uses measuring and diagnostic tools to test and modify electronic parts. Supports engineering in new builds and maintains the needs of existing equipment. Ensures systems and components meet established specifications. Requires enrollment in an apprenticeship and/or formal training program in the area of specialty.
Position SummaryThe Electronics Technician is responsible for installing, maintaining, troubleshooting, and repairing electrical and electronic systems and equipment. This role ensures all work complies with applicable electrical codes, safety regulations, and quality standards while supporting both new system builds and ongoing operational needs.
